Sanctuary of Arantzazu
Church
Photo: Keta, CC BY-SA 2.5.
The Sanctuary of Our Lady of Arantzazu is a Franciscan church located in Oñati, Basque Country, Spain. The church is a much-loved place among Gipuzkoans, as the Virgin of Arantzazu is the shrine’s namesake and patron saint of the province, alongside Ignatius of Loyola. Sanctuary of Arantzazu is situated 4 km southeast of Sandaili etxea.
